Sunday markets popping up at Portobello this Christmas

portobello
  • Portobello Market will be opening on Sundays in the run-up to Christmas to provide visitors with an extra day of shopping
  • ‘Christmas at Portobello’ will be popping up on 5, 12 and 19 December, 10 am to 4 pm
  • Up to 180 different stalls will be on offer across the 3 dates and special performances including local choirs to add to the festive feeling

Christmas is coming to Portobello with special markets on the first three Sundays in December, the first taking place just after Small Business Saturday on 5 December.

Typically limited to Thorpe Close and Acklam Road on Sundays, the entire street market in Portobello Market will be buzzing with an extra day of shopping in the run-up to Christmas as well as exciting street food and drinks on offer from 10 am to 4 pm.

To add to the festive feeling, performers will be taking to the stage, located between Lancaster Road and the Westway flyover, including local choirs and musicians; New Generation Steel Orchestra, the Treblemakers, Techtonics, Nostalgia Steel Band, UFO Steel Band, Ebony Steel Band, and Portobello Road Choir.

Organised in partnership between Kensington and Chelsea Council, Portobello Green Market and the Westway Trust, ‘Christmas at Portobello’ will bring plenty of cheer to the borough through the community.
